How often should you provide feedback to volunteers?
Once per year
Once per quarter
Every month
Regularly, as needed
Answer explanation
Providing feedback regularly, as needed, ensures that volunteers receive timely guidance and support, which can enhance their performance and engagement. This approach is more effective than infrequent feedback.

What is the most common reason volunteers leave organizations?
Lack of clear expectations
Poor supervision
Feeling undervalued
Lack of recognition
Answer explanation
Volunteers often leave organizations because they feel undervalued. When their contributions are not recognized or appreciated, it can lead to dissatisfaction and a desire to seek more fulfilling opportunities.

Which of the following is NOT a key competency for managing volunteers?
Communication
Empathy
Conflict resolution
Micromanagement
Answer explanation
Micromanagement is not a key competency for managing volunteers, as it involves excessive control and oversight, which can undermine volunteers' autonomy and motivation. Effective management focuses on communication, empathy, and conflict resolution.

What's the best way to resolve an issue with an underperforming volunteer?
Give them more tasks
Ignore it and hope it improves
Provide specific, constructive feedback
Reassign them immediately
Answer explanation
Providing specific, constructive feedback helps the volunteer understand their shortcomings and improve their performance. This approach fosters communication and growth, unlike ignoring the issue or overloading them with tasks.
